Tony Finau Early Life
Tony Finau’s early life in Salt Lake City, Utah, was shaped by his Polynesian heritage and a working-class background. Born on September 14, 1989, to a family of Tongan and Samoan descent, he grew up alongside six siblings in a home where resources were limited.
His father, Kelepi Finau, played a crucial role in nurturing his son’s passion for golf despite the family’s financial constraints.

At just 17, Finau turned professional, navigating an unorthodox path in a sport often dominated by those with elite training facilities.
His brother, Gipper Finau, also supported him during this challenging journey, fostering a sense of camaraderie that would prove vital as Tony faced numerous obstacles on the road to success.

Tony Finau Career
Tony Finau’s career has rapidly ascended in the world of professional golf since he turned pro in 2014. By 2016, he secured his PGA Tour status and marked his presence with a top-10 finish at the Puerto Rico Open.
His performance continued to impress, highlighted by a fifth-place finish at the prestigious Masters in 2018 and participation in the Ryder Cup that same year. Finau’s consistency has made him a formidable competitor in major tournaments.

The turning point in Finau’s career came in 2021 when he claimed his first PGA Tour victory at the Rocket Mortgage Classic. He followed this success with a second win at the Houston Open in 2022, solidifying his reputation as a consistent contender on tour.
As of 2025, Finau remains a prominent figure on the PGA Tour, continuously showcasing his talent in both individual and team events.
